This is the second round of public consultation on the upgrades.
Irish Rail is asking communities along the DART routes for their views on plans for the DART + WEST, once again.
The proposal will see the electrified network extended from Connolly/Spencer Dock area to west of Maynooth and to the M3 Parkway.

This is the second round of public consultation on the upgrades.
Changes from the first round include the removal of a bridge at Coolmine, an increase in the number of trains per hour from 6 to 12, and a proposed new station at Spencer Dock.
